Batman v Superman Rock ‘Em Sock ‘Em Robots Toy

Remember Rock ‘Em Sock ‘Em Robots? That was a fun fighting game. We played it, our parents played it in their day, and now the kids of today have a new version with Batman and Superman duking it out. The toy is based on their epic battle in the new movie,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ice.

There will be some truly epic fights between the Dark Knight and the Man of Steel in the new movie and you will be able to recreate them with this brawling toy. This version is $30(USD) and has been upgraded with electronic sound effects, otherwise it is still the same as the original – with one stupid exception. Instead of their heads popping up (which was everyone’s favorite part of the game,) either character pops off their base when they have had enough of a beating.

Tomy BattroBorg 20 throws motion-controlled punches, rocks ’em and socks ’em Wii-style (video)

Tomy BattroBorg 20 runs on motioncontrolled punches, rocks 'em and socks 'em Wiistyle

The last time we saw someone move the game on for Rock'em Sock'em Robots, it was a motion-controlled experiment that was unlikely to see the light of day. Tomy must have been frustrated enough waiting for the practical reality to take matters into its own hands, as it's just unveiled the BattroBorg 20, a fighting robot that... lets you take matters into your own hands. The toy uses a Wii-style nunchuk motion controller that translates the player's own thrusts into the plastic robot's punches. Each robot can tell if it's been decked, although it takes just five punches to win by TKO -- these aren't exactly Queensbury rules. At an estimated $50 for each robot and matching controller on the July 14th release date, the BattroBorg isn't the cheapest way to relive the glory days of pint-sized fisticuffs, but it's certainly the most involving.
